Love to the detail or devil in the detail? Maybe both … often it is the small mistakes and weaknesses in a web design and development project that make work difficult: some bugs in the software, spelling mistakes or the graphics and colours need adjusting. This can quickly lead to frustrations, more... Read more
This company has no org chart yet
This company has no teams yet
This company has no offices yet